Description
A boy and a talking horse share an adventurous and dangerous journey to Narnia to warn of invading barbarians.

Notes
General Note
First published in Great Britain by Geoffrey Bles in 1954. Colour edition first published in 1998. This hardback edition first published in Great Britain in 2014.
